The Qualcomm AR8328-AK1A is a highly integrated Gigabit Ethernet switch controller designed for use in networking devices. This chip provides robust switching capabilities, making it ideal for a variety of networking applications requiring high bandwidth and low latency. It's commonly found in routers, switches, and other network infrastructure equipment.

Additional Details
The AR8328-AK1A typically supports a variety of Ethernet standards, including IEEE 802.3, 802.3u, and 802.3ab. It may include features like link aggregation, port mirroring, and loop detection. The chip's architecture is optimized for efficient packet processing, ensuring minimal latency and high throughput. Specific features can vary depending on the implementation and configuration, but the AR8328-AK1A is generally designed to meet the demands of modern networking environments requiring fast and reliable Gigabit Ethernet connectivity.
